What is the purpose of a coupling capacitor?

A coupling capacitor does the same work as its name suggests, that is coupling one stage of the electronic circuit with another. It does that without passing the DC bias voltages between stages so that these stages are not affected by each other.To block or avoid the flow of D.C and to allow only A.C

What is the function of a coupling capacitor?

A coupling capacitor is used to block the flow of direct current while allowing alternating or signal currents to pass, hence mainly used for joining two stages in radio and amplifier circuits.Also known as blocking capacitor or stopping capacitor. They are also used in substations within a "wave trap" where communication is done by a.c. power line and any d.c. signals need to be attenuated or blocked.


What are the steps behind installing a car audio capacitor?

First, the capacitor must be charged. Use a voltmeter, and when it reaches 12 volts, the capacitor is charged. The capacitor should then be installed near the car audio amplifier. Keep the negative wire attached to the battery. Then, a ground wire from the negative post on the capacitor to the car's chassis on the chassis's bare metal ground point. Next, the power wire needs to be disconnected from the amplifier's power input. Connect the wire to the positive post on the capacitor. A new power wire needs to be connected from the capacitor's positive post to the amplifier's power input. Install a 16 gauge wire from the capacitor's remote turn-on post to the amplifier's remote input. Then disconnect the negative wire from the battery.
